The statement was made during a meeting in Hanoi on February 13 between Sen Lt Gen Do Ba Ty, deputy minister of national defence and chief of the General Staff of the Vietnam People's Army, and Gen Moeldoko, chief of staff of the Indonesian National Armed Forces.
Gen Ty expressed his hope that Gen Moeldoko's visit would boost friendship and co-operation between the two peoples and armies, towards each nation's interests and the construction of the ASEAN community by 2015.
Both sides discussed several regional and international issues of mutual concern, reviewed their military ties and proposed measures to improve the relationship in the future.
They agreed to increase exchanges and high-level meetings to enhance mutual understanding and trust, creating common views on regional and international issues and bilateral ties.
In addition, the two sides will promote the naval co-operation mechanism, study potential co-operation in other areas and work towards the establishment of appropriate consultative mechanisms, while enhancing mutual support at multilateral forums and on issues of mutual concern.
